����� 201.270 Polk County. (1) The boundary of Polk County is as follows: Commencing at the southeast corner of Yamhill County, in the center of the main channel of the Willamette River in township 6 south, range 3 west of the Willamette Meridian; thence N 89� 42� 43� W, 900 feet to a brass cap set in the base of the mon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 42� 43 � W, 5,256.03 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 51� 52� W, 14,356.78 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 48� 05 � W, 1,314.22 feet to an aluminum pipe and aluminum cap monument; thence N 89� 59� 01� W, 3,093.00 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 59� 32� W, 3,487.12 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 54� 09� W, 891.58 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 52� 36� W, 1,131.35 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ence S 89� 53� 16� W, 6,000.53 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 40� 14� W, 2,690.80 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 41� 16� W, 2,708.54 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 52� 16� W, 9,925.57 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 21� 07� W, 13,631.79 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ence S 89� 53� 01� W, 4,749.60 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ence S 89� 52� 12� W, 4,379.73 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ence S 89� 51� 31� W, 6,113.50 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ence S 89� 50� 30� W, 8,340.37 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 51� 36� W, 5,111.72 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ence S 89� 29� 45� W, 4,479.59 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ence S 89� 29� 01� W, 2,258.39 feet to a point five links north of a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ote a reference to the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 53� 46� W, 6,983.34 feet to a brass cap set in concrete; thence S 89� 33� 19� W, 8,919.81 feet to an aluminum pipe and aluminum cap monument; thence N 88� 40� 09� W, 7,840.11 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 88� 41� 27� W, 6,684.99 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 56� 52� W, 9,123.08 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 58� 22� W, 7,936.58 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 29� 17� W, 1,312.89 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 46� 31� W, 14,458.42 feet to an iron pipe and brass cap monument; thence N 89� 00� 46� W, 615.90 feet to a cast iron pyramid monument set in 1890 to denote the boundary between Polk and Yamhill Counties; thence N 89� 53� 34� W, 4,775.55 feet to the northwest corner of Polk County, which is monumented with an iron pipe and brass cap, as depicted on the county line survey of 2003, which lies on the west boundary of and 62.16 chains southerly from the northwest corner of township 6 south, range 8 west; thence south to the north boundary line of Benton County; thence east along the north boundary line of Benton County to the center of the main channel of the Willamette River; thence down the center of the main channel of the Willamette River where that main channel existed on January 8, 2003, to the confluence of the Santiam River; thence down the center of the main channel of the Willamette River where that main channel was located on June 22, 1981, to the place of beginning, all land on the east of the line last above described being a part of Marion County.

����� (2) When the Willamette River serves as the boundary between Linn and Polk Counties in subsection (1) of this section, a reference to the river refers to the center of the main channel of the Willamette River as it existed on January 8, 2003, and may be further identified using coordinates and other location information determined by the affected county surveyors and filed by the appropriate counties with the appropriate county assessors and the Department of Revenue under ORS 308.225. [Amended by 1981 c.332 �2; 1983 c.780 �1; 2003 c.97 �1; 2003 c.622 �5a]

����� 201.280 Sherman County. The boundary of Sherman County is as follows: Beginning at a point on the boundary of the state opposite the mouth of the John Day River; thence up the middle of the main channel of John Day River to the intersection of such channel and the township line between townships 5 and 6 south; thence west along the south township line of township 5 south to the middle of Buck Hollow; thence down the middle of Buck Hollow to the intersection of Buck Creek and Deschutes River; thence down the main channel of the Deschutes River to a point on the boundary of the state opposite the mouth of the Deschutes River; thence in a general easterly direction along the boundary of the state to the place of beginning. [Amended by 1967 c.421 �194]

����� 201.310 Union County. The boundary of Union County is as follows: Commencing at a point where the forty-sixth parallel of latitude crosses the summit of the Blue Mountains; thence east along such line to its intersection with Snake River; thence up the middle of the channel of the river to the mouth of the Powder River; thence up the middle channel of the river to the mouth of the north fork of the same; thence up the main channel of the North Powder River to its source; thence west to a point intersecting the east boundary line of Umatilla County; thence northerly along such line to the place of beginning.

����� 201.370 Boundaries of counties bordering Pacific Ocean. (1) The boundaries of all counties bordering on the Pacific Ocean extend to the western boundary of the state as defined in the Oregon Constitution.

����� (2) Notwithstanding the provisions of subsection (1) of this section, planning for ocean resources and for submerged and submersible lands of the territorial sea shall be accomplished as set forth in ORS 196.405 to 196.515. [Amended by 1987 c.576 �22]
